Maestro Harrell and I couldn’t have had much more of a different upbringing which made this conversation incredibly interesting and enjoyable for me. Maestro has been in the public eye virtually his entire life. His parents had him taking piano lessons as a toddler, and he already had a major role on the tv show “Guys like us” at the age of 7. He’s originally from Chicago, but due to his early success in entertainment he’s been flying all over the world his whole life. He’s arguably known most as the character “Randy” from his years working on the hit tv show “The Wire”, but he’s a hell of a lot more than that. Just check out his Wikipedia page to find his very long list of credentials including putting out several rap albums, producing others work, making music for commercials, and designing clothing. Despite having such a different lifestyle, we really connected and this is one of my favorite episodes I’ve done so far. Maestro is such a down to earth, open minded, and kind individual.
